Reanimate Corpse
Nightsister witches that study necromancy learn to reanimate corpses to use as zombie warriors. The spell only ends when the caster ends the spell or the zombie is defeated.

The patriarch of this family, known only as the Father, has spent ages maintaining the balance between his Daughter, who is strong with the light side of the Force, and his Son, who aligns with the dark. The Father reveals his days are numbered, and he seeks Anakin to take his place as the fulcrum of this balance. A test proves that Anakin is capable of controlling both offspring, as the Father does, but Skywalker refuses to take the Father’s place.

Read moreThe Terrapin-class Bulk Tanker, also known as the Goji-DF or Turtle Tanker, was a utilitarian starship manufactured by the Corellia Mining Corporation and was used throughout the galaxy during the Clone Wars, with spacious holds that could be partitioned to allow for simultaneous transport of a variety of cargo.
